Disability shower installation services involve designing and setting up accessible shower spaces tailored to meet specific mobility needs. These installations often include features such as low or no-threshold entryways, grab bars, non-slip flooring, and adjustable showerheads to enhance safety and independence. Contractors specializing in these services work to create a functional and comfortable environment that accommodates individuals with disabilities, seniors, or those with limited mobility, ensuring the shower area is both practical and user-friendly.
This service addresses common challenges faced by individuals with mobility impairments, such as difficulty entering traditional showers, risk of slips and falls, and the need for additional support features. Properly installed disability showers can help reduce the likelihood of accidents, improve ease of use, and promote greater independence in daily routines. The overview below groups typical Disability Shower Installation proj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Needham, MA.
In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.
Installation Costs - The cost for installing a disability shower typically ranges from $1,500 to $5,000, depending on the complexity and materials used. Basic installations may be closer to the lower end, while custom features can increase the price.
Material Expenses - Materials for disability showers, such as accessible fixtures and non-slip tiles, can add $500 to $2,500 to the overall cost. The choice of durable, accessible materials influences the final price.
Labor Fees - Labor costs for professional installation generally fall between $1,000 and $3,500, varying by location and the scope of work. More intricate setups or modifications may require additional labor charges.
Additional Features - Installing accessible features like grab bars, seating, or specialized controls can range from $200 to $1,000 extra. These enhancements improve functionality but may increase overall expenses.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What is involved in installing a disability shower? Installation typically includes replacing or modifying existing shower components to accommodate accessibility features, ensuring proper plumbing and safety measures are in place.
Can a disability shower be customized for specific needs? Yes, local service providers can customize features such as grab bars, seating, and non-slip surfaces to meet individual requirements.
Is professional installation necessary for a disability shower? Professional installation is recommended to ensure safety, compliance with building codes, and proper functionality of accessibility features.
What types of disability showers are available? There are various options including walk-in showers, roll-in showers, and curbless designs, which can be tailored to different mobility needs.
